If anyone else is suffering from computer eyestrain that just gets worse year after year - regardless of sunglasses, dim screens, bigger screens, or black backgrounds with green font - and yet your career depends on using a screen...

Try a projector. 

It's mildly cumbersome, and people may think you're weird, but used projectors come cheap and your screen can be a bed sheet draped over a broom handle.  This is an Epson Powerlite S5, 3 LCD, ten years old and going strong.  I've been using it for a year, and honestly think my writing career may have been over without it - the headaches were that bad.  Read about the dangerous cumulative effects of digital light on your eyes here.  I've started eating fish oil, too; omega-3's have made the eye dryness go away completely.  I used to use eye drops eight times a day.  Now, not at all.
